Waste Land - A documentary about Vik Muniz by Lucy Walker

This has been in my queue since the Oscars and we finally got around to watching it last night. Tim and I both highly recommend it - a truly moving story about the transformational power of art. I loved when Muniz described how people experience an artwork - the moment when the image is transformed into the material. Also, his sincerity in collaborating with the garbage pickers to create their portraits was inspiring. Tim, of course, was more fascinated by the sociological aspects of the film - seeing the pickers getting ready to attend the opening at the Museu de Arte Moderna Rio de Janeiro prompted much commentary on the contrast between the favelas and the upper class communities which they surround.
